About the role

This is a highly skilled nursing role where you’ll be accountable and responsible for supporting people’s holistic needs. It requires a range of clinical and nursing skills.

You’ll provide the highest standards of nursing care for adults living with complex care and health needs. Our care focuses on maximising independence and building everyday living skills.

No two days will ever be the same, but your day-to-day responsibilities will include:

  1. assessing, planning and providing person-centred nursing care for the people we support
  2. the safe administration of medication
  3. promoting health and wellbeing
  4. being the Nurse in Charge of a small unit whilst on shift
  5. managing situations when people display behaviours of concern
  6. promoting choice, dignity, independence and respect

Above all, you’re someone who identifies with our Exemplar Health Care values of fun, integrity, responsiveness, success and teamwork.

You’ll also be:

  1. a great role model – able to coach, teach and support your colleagues
  2. someone with a calm nature who can deal with, and defuse, challenging situations
  3. an advocate of best practice in nursing
  4. able to demonstrate a range of clinical skills
  5. knowledgeable about assessment, admission and discharge processes
  6. knowledgeable of the Mental Capacity Act and Deprivation of Liberty Safeguards and committed to working within its Codes of Practice
